Finance Intern

PNY TECHNOLOGIES, INC.

 

US-NJ-Parsippany – Finance Intern



PNY Technologies, Inc. is a leading manufacturer and supplier of computer graphics cards, memory upgrade modules, flash memory and flash peripherals.  Its memory products currently account for a majority share of all retail sales in the US.  PNY products are available at major retail outlets, mail order outlets, online retailers, value-added resellers and distribution channels throughout the US and Europe.  Headquartered in Parsippany, New Jersey, PNY maintains operations in North America, Europe and Asia.  For more information on PNY, please visit our website at www.pny.com.

 

Currently, we have openings for Finance Intern in our Parsippany, NJ facility.  The responsibilities for this position include:

·  Assisting in monthly and quarterly profit reconciliation calculations

·  Monthly Expense analysis

·  Quarterly actual vs. budget analysis

·  Monthly vendor credit calculations

·  POS and Mail-in rebate accrual calculations

·  Gathering backup for customer claims

·  Inventory test counts

·  Other clerical duties as assigned

 

 Requirements:

 

·  High school diploma or equivalent preferred

·  0-6 months related office experience

·  Working towards Accounting/Finance degree preferred

·  Previous clerical experience preferred

·  Strong Excel skills

·  Good reading, writing and arithmetic skills required

·  Attention to detail

·  Ability to follow directions

·  Ability to communicate effectively in English
